A reasonable tim frame for a job of this magnitude is estimated at approximately <br />1300 hours for backfilling and grading, and 100 hours for topsoiling. Assuming three D11 dozers working <br />two shifts per day backfilling and grading anc~ four 637 scrapers topsoiling one shift per day, total project time <br />is estimated at 8 months.
